Ex-dividend reminder: Interactive Brokers Group, Columbia Property Trust and Associated Banc-Corp

THELooking at the universe of stocks we cover on Dividend Channel, on 08/31/21, Interactive Brokers Group Inc – Class A (symbol: IBKR), Columbia Property Trust Inc (symbol: CXP) and Associated Banc-Corp (symbol : ASB) will all trade ex-dividend for their respective next dividends. Interactive Brokers Group Inc – Class A will pay its quarterly dividend of $ 0.10 on 09/14/21, Columbia Property Trust Inc will pay its quarterly dividend of $ 0.21 on 09/15/21 and Associated Banc-Corp will pay its dividend quarterly $ 0.20 on 09/15/21. As a percentage of the recent IBKR stock price of $ 63.86 this dividend is around 0.16%, so look for shares of Interactive Brokers Group Inc – Class A that are trading 0.16% lower. – all other things being equal – when the IBKR shares are open for trading on 08/31/21. Likewise, investors should look for a price 1.25% below CXP and a price 0.97% below ASB, all other things being equal.

In general, dividends are not always predictable, following the ups and downs in corporate profits over time. Therefore, a good first step in due diligence in forming an annual performance expectation in the future is to look at the above history, for a sense of stability over time. This can help judge whether the most recent dividends from these companies are likely to continue. If continued, the current estimated returns on an annualized basis would be 0.63% for Interactive Brokers Group Inc – Class A, 4.99% for Columbia Property Trust Inc and 3.88% for Associated Banc-Corp .
